1. An adaptive video recording system for selectively recording a plurality of video signals outputted from a plurality of video sources one after another, comprising:

  • a recording disc, to which at least the video signals and recording information data related to the video signals, are to be recorded in a directly accessible manner;

    a recorder for recording the video signals, by a field or frame unit in a time divisional manner by use of a recording format, which is set in accordance with the number of said video sources (k) and in which a field or frame number of the video signals of each video source is expressed by {kn+(1, 2, ..., k)} on said recording disc wherein k denotes the number of said video sources and n denotes the block number of the video signals, and the recording information data, which is related to the video signals and includes information indicating the number of said video sources (k) and the block number (n), to said recording disc; and

    a switcher, coupled to said video sources and said recorder, for switching and outputting the video signals from said video sources to said recorder by the field or frame unit.
